About Accommodation
The Pimpilala Lodge is located in the Amazon jungle, 45 minutes
from Tena. The lodge offers varied basic accommodation in rustic
wooden huts or bungalows, both with mosquito nets. All travelers
will have access to shared showers (no hot water) and toilets
outside of the rooms but located very nearby. A local family
lives in the main lodge and they encourage people to hang out and
see how they cook. A common area with hammocks is a popular place
to relax.

Fausto Llerena Breeding Center & Charles Darwin Research Station VisitPuerto Ayora45m
Visit Fausto Llerena Breeding Center a great place to observe many species of tortoises and land iguanas in captivity. Brought back from the brink of
extinction, see the famous Galapagos tortoise up close a corral houses adult tortoises, and a nursery cares for the young until around age three when their
shells have hardened.
This area also houses the Charles Darwin Research Station, a scientific organization initiated in 1964, which works to preserve the Galapagos ecosystem
through the conservation efforts of scientists, researchers, and volunteers. While the offices themselves are not open to visitors, the research station
provides a study location for international scientists and environmental education for the local community.

Your G for Good Moment: Floreana Community Guesthouse
Floreana Island is a small, isolated, inhabited island part of the Galpagos Archipelago. Many of its residents have been living there for the past three
generations since the islands were first colonized. Its 150 residents have tried to benefit from the tourism boom, but since most tourism is marine-based and
the boats don't stop in the village, they have struggled to find any opportunities. We are investing in community training and infrastructure to develop the first
ecological, community tourism program in the Galpagos Islands that sees both the island's small entrepreneurs and its unique wildlife as the primary
beneficiaries of this project.

GALAPAGOS ISLAND PARK ENTRY FEE
The Ecuadorian government currently levies a Galpagos Islands Park entry fee of $100 USD per person. This is payable at the airport
upon arrival in the park. It is not included in the cost of the tour and must be paid in CASH. This fee funds Park maintenance and supervision in Galpagos, as well as ecological study, conservation, and infrastructure development in Ecuador's other National Parks.
Entry fees and the funds they generate for the National Park System are among measures taken by the Ecuadorian government to protect its natural heritage.


TRANSIT CONTROL CARDS
The Consejo de Gobierno (local government council) has implemented a system of Transit Control Cards at a fee of $20 USD per person.
This card is to be purchased in CASH at a counter in the Quito
airport before boarding the flight to the Galapagos. Please retain
this card along with your passport as you will be required to
present this upon arrival to the Galapagos Islands. Please note
that this applies to all tourists entering the Galapagos Islands
and is a supplement to the existing entry fee to the National Park
and is not controlled by tour operators or travel agencies. It is
the first of a number of initiatives to track, control and maintain
the sustainable tourism targets set out by the Galapagos National
Park and the Ecuadorian government in an attempt to preserve the
fragile environment of the archipelago.


INTERNATIONAL TICKET NUMBERS
All travelers are required to pay the tax on domestic flights in
Ecuador. Foreign travelers are exempt from this, and proving you
are indeed a foreign traveler can be done by providing us with
your international ticket number (ITN). Travelers who do not
submit international ticket numbers at least 30 days prior to Day 1
of their tour will be required to pay the domestic tax on all included flights.
